Pacific Center for Financial Services's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Pacific Center for Financial Services held 480 positions worth $392M, up 6.4% from $369M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 73%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q3 2025: portfolio turnover was 4.2%. Pacific Center for Financial Services opened 15 new positions and exited 5, leaving the 480-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.4% of assets, up from 4.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
